Obon Dance & Festival

June 3, 2016 @ 5:00 pm - 9:00 pm
|Recurring Event (See all)

An event every day that begins at 5:00 pm, repeating until June 4, 2016

Lihue Hongwanji Buddhist Temple, Kuhio Hwy HI United States + Google Map

Throughout the Month of June:  Obon Dance & Festival.  The Obon tradition was brought to Hawai`i by Japanese immigrants and evolved into a social and cultural event, as well as a religious custom designed to honor ancestors through an evening of dance, music and merry-making.  Free.  Festivities and Dance schedules and locations are listed below: Friday & Saturday, June 3 & 4:  Lihue Hongwanji Buddhist Temple, Kuhio Hwy, across from Kapaia Stitchery (nearest cross street, Kuene St.), Festivities being at…
